Overview of BitFuFu's Third Quarter Financial Results
BitFuFu Inc. (NASDAQ: FUFU), a leader in digital asset mining services, has showcased a substantial performance report for the third quarter of 2024. This period highlights the company’s resilience and its adaptive strategies within the cryptocurrency mining sector. With a focus on operational efficiency and building a diversified portfolio, BitFuFu has made impressive strides, reflecting its commitment to financial growth and sustainability.
Operational Highlights
During the third quarter of 2024, BitFuFu reported notable operational achievements:
- The hosting capacity surged to 556 MW, significantly up from 339 MW in the previous year, now spread across 17 sites on three continents.
- Furthermore, the total mining capacity under management saw an astounding increase of 88.5%, reaching 26.2 EH/s compared to 13.9 EH/s from the same quarter last year.
- Registered users for cloud mining solutions skyrocketed by 75.3%, climbing to 455,764, showcasing the growing interest in the services offered by BitFuFu.
- Despite the overall growth, Bitcoin production from self-mining operations dropped by 34.0%, totaling 340 BTCs down from 515 BTCs the previous year.
- Productions from customers utilizing cloud-mining solutions also faced a decline, with a 40.7% decrease to 957 BTCs compared to prior figures.
- The average cost to mine Bitcoin via self-mining operations climbed to US$59,452, reflecting the increasing challenges in the mining landscape.
Strategic Diversification and Expansion Initiatives
BitFuFu is not just resting on its laurels; the company has set a solid strategic framework aimed at expanding its footprint and enhancing operational flexibility:
- A significant transition is underway as BitFuFu shifts from an asset-light strategy to one that fosters a strong and adaptable mining infrastructure portfolio. Recently, the company announced a definitive agreement to acquire a 51.25% stake in an 80-MW Bitcoin mining facility.
- This newly acquired facility promises to optimize BitFuFu's energy costs, boasting rates below US$0.04 per kilowatt-hour, which is crucial in managing operational costs.
- Leveraging its established presence in the United States, this acquisition is poised to offer a substantial competitive edge in the global market.
Financial Performance Overview
In terms of financial results, BitFuFu recorded a total revenue of USD 90.3 million for Q3 2024, marking a robust 47.5% rise from USD 61.2 million in the previous year. The growth is primarily propelled by:
- Revenue generation within the cloud-mining sector, which recorded an impressive increase of 51.4%, resulting in USD 68.9 million this quarter.
- The company noted that recurring revenue from customers remained consistent, showcasing a net dollar retention rate of 95.6%, highlighting customer satisfaction and repeat engagement.
- However, a net loss was reported at USD 5.0 million, an increase from USD 2.7 million in the same period last year, primarily attributed to share-based compensation expenses.
- Despite the net loss, adjusted EBITDA rose to USD 5.8 million, showcasing BitFuFu’s ability to navigate financial complexities with success.
